Techniques and questions to ask when using the internet for research:

• Train your eye to look to employ a series of techniques that will assist in locating what you need

• Train your mind to think critically by asking a series of questions that will help you decide if the information can be trusted.

What is the internet good for?

• Quick facts (contact info, maps)• Social networking (myspace, facebook,

blogs, wikis)• Shopping!• Current news

Don’t use the internet…

• For locating scholarly articles– These are often found on the “deep web” in

databases not commonly found using a search engine such as Google.

• As your only research tool– Use books, journals and subscription

databases when conducting research.

Guidelines for Evaluating Web Sites

• “Author”ity

• Accuracy

• Objectivity

• Currency

• Coverage & Comparability• Maintenance & Design
